Historic Mill District high-rise condo, 2BR + office, 2 bath, 2,389 SF. Modern-industrial loft with floor-to-ceiling windows, polished concrete floors, exposed concrete columns, and industrial ductwork throughout. A beautiful home for entertaining and those looking for a boutique building in the heart of one of Minnesota's most prestigious neighborhoods. Living room features wide-plank hardwood on a raised platform, linear decorative fireplace, and wall-mounted TV. Open kitchen with hardwood cabinetry, black granite island with bar seating, professional-grade range, stainless appliances, and subway tile backsplash. Formal dining area with private balcony adjacent. Primary suite with soaking tub, separate walk-in shower, mosaic tile floors, and expansive walk-in closet. Second bedroom and dedicated office/den. Building amenities include rooftop terrace with Mississippi River views on same floor as the unit. 2 heated underground parking stalls (8B & 9B) with EV charging and storage cage — directly outside the lobby. HOA $2,369/mo includes heat, AC, gas, cable, internet, professional mgmt. and more. Steps to Guthrie, Saturday Farmer's Market, and river trails. A striking Tudor-style American Foursquare in the heart of Tangletown, this is the kind of home they simply do not build anymore. Boxy and confident, with its stucco and brick exterior, half-timbered gable, wide eaves, and deep, beadboard-ceilinged brick porch, it carries the period character that defined Minneapolis's most beloved neighborhoods. The charm you see from the curb walks straight through the front door and never lets up. Inside, the original woodwork is the star: rich, dark-stained trim, French doors, and the beamed ceilings that give the dining room a distinctly Tudor warmth you simply cannot replicate. These are the hallmarks of a home built in an era when craftsmanship came first, and they have been beautifully preserved. The light is something to behold, too. Windows line nearly every room, from sunny bay windows in the bedrooms to the glass-wrapped sunroom upstairs, filling the home with natural light all day long while keeping every space connected to the trees and street outside. The living room centers on a grand brick fireplace, a true gathering spot, while a second gas fireplace warms the cozy sitting room tucked between the dining room and kitchen. True to the Foursquare tradition, the layout favors defined, comfortable rooms over one wide-open space. For the buyer who still values cozy, private spaces and an authentic floor plan, this is the home that has been missing from the market. The kitchen is where old meets new the right way. Thoughtfully updated with quartz counters, custom cabinetry, and professional-grade stainless appliances, it delivers the function today's buyers expect while honoring everything that makes this house special. Upstairs, the owner suite opens to a private upper deck, a genuinely rare retreat. A basement sauna off of the family room and a private backyard hot tub round out a wellness setup you almost never see in homes of this era. What truly sets this property apart is the rare double lot. In a neighborhood where space is at a premium, the extra land delivers room to breathe: a private backyard, the setting for that hot tub retreat, and the kind of three-car garage almost impossible to find in Tangletown. Add over 4,000 finished square feet, 5 bedrooms, and 5 baths, and this becomes a genuinely rare offering. All of it just a short walk to Fuller Park, a local favorite for kids and adults alike, with neighborhood eateries, shopping, and the city lakes walking and biking trails close at hand.
